Kazuhiro, sorry but no idea what this 'unknown error' might be just based on seeing a screen image.

Please ensure that you have the latest build #39620 for ACPHO installed as this fixes some issues that came with the initial release build of the application.

Beyond that, download a copy of the latest MVP Assistant tool from the link in forum topic: MVP Assistant update for Acronis Cyber Protect Home Office - where the author (Bruno) has provided an updated version to work with ACPHO - MVP Assistant 1.1.2.0

The logs should be able to give more information on what error is being encountered?

If you have Disks & Partitions backups created on ATI 2020 or later using .tibx files, then look in the Backup Worker logs.

If you have Files & Folders backups using .tib files (or Disk backups from earlier versions using .tib files) or using Cloning then look in the Demon logs.

Other logs are shown by the MVP Assistant under the 'Active Logs' heading of the Log Viewer page of the Assistant.

The log files should be zipped to preserve their original file names if sharing in the forums and would need to be less than 3MB in size, otherwise you would need to share the zip file via a Cloud share service such as OneDrive, Dropbox etc.

Kazuhiro,

It is difficult for me to tell exactly what your screenshot indicates due to language barrier.  having said that I believe this error is what would be seen when the application cannot find the backup task location.  Where are the backup files located exactly, external usb disk, internal sata disk, mapped network drive?

It may be necessary to remove the backup task itself from the application without removing the backup files themselves and then adding the backup file location back into the GUI to get things working again.
